FP3: Sainz ‘conscious' after high-speed crash

Carlos Sainz suffered a huge crash in final practice for the Russian GP bringing out the red flags in a session that was topped by Nico Rosberg. Following the diesel drama and rain from Friday, the drivers were determined to get in as much running as possible in FP3. However, that came to a premature end just past the halfway point when Sainz suffered a horrific crash. The Toro Rosso driver appears to have lost it under braking into Turn 13 and hit the outside wall. From there he went straight on through the run-off area before his car was buried under the tec-pro safety barriers.
